html { height: 100%; margin-bottom: 1px;}

body { margin: 0;
           background-image: url(img/topbar.gif); background-repeat: repeat-x;
           background:#000019;
           text-align:center;
           color:#f4f4f4; }

td.side_bg {
                   background-image: url(img/topbar.gif); background-repeat: repeat-x;
                    }

/*  TOP PART +++++++++++++++++++++++++++++++++++++ */

td.barre_top { background-color: #686868;
                                height: 4px;
                                padding: 0px; margin: 0px;
                                font-size: 1pt;
                                }

div.logo { background-image: url(img/top.png); background-repeat: no-repeat;
         height: 80px;
         margin-left:150px;
         }

td.middle { background-image: url(img/middle.gif); background-repeat: repeat-y;
            padding-top: 12px;
            margin-left: 10px;
            }

td.end { background-image: url(img/end.gif); background-repeat: no-repeat;
         height:137px;
         }

td.bg_end { background-image: url(img/pattern.gif); background-repeat: repeat-x;
            height: 137px;
            }


/*  DIV CONTENT +++++++++++++++++++++++++++++++++++++ */

    #content {
           padding: 0px;
           margin-left: 9px;
           margin-right: 12px;
           font-family: Verdana,  sans-serif;
            font-size: 8pt; font-weight: normal;
            }

/* NOTE HEADER BOX +++++++++++++++++++++++++++++++++++++ */

td.note_header {
            padding: 20px;
        font-family:Verdana, Arial, Helvetica, sans-serif;
        font-size:9pt;
        color: 898080;

        line-height: 1.8em; }


/* CONTACT BOX +++++++++++++++++++++++++++++++++++++ */

#contact {
            font-family: Trebuchet, Verdana, Arial, Helvetica, sans-serif;
            font-size: 8pt;
            padding-left: 300px;
        color: 9b9b9b;
        font-weight: normal;
        line-height: 1.8em;
        }

input,textarea {
            background-color: #fefefe;
                border:1px #dedede solid;
                Text-align: left;
        font-family: Verdana, Arial, Helvetica, sans-serif;
        font-size: 8pt;
        color: #7b7b7b;
        padding-left: 2px;
        }
textarea {
        padding: 2 2 2 2px;
        }
